Description

This combination adds a bright elegant wing to the spectacular A line, easily creating a residence with five bedrooms, 4-5 bathrooms plus library. The high ceilings, original details such as hard wood floors and wood burning fireplace, continue in the F line apartment. A room of grand proportions with a south facing bay window lets in beautiful light and wonderful views of Harperley Hall's handsome courtyard and the lights of Columbus Circle beyond. Currently set up as a one bedroom, one bathroom apartment with attractive kitchen and grand living room, when combined with 11A the options are endless, creating a large scale Central Park West apartment with incomparable views, 75 feet of frontage and a one of a kind balcony.

The Upper West Side (UWS) is celebrated for its cultural richness and architectural grandeur. Set between Central Park and Riverside Park, the neighborhood provides direct access to green space within the urban grid. Residents enjoy easy access to Lincoln Center, the American Museum of Natural History, and a popular culinary scene. The real estate landscape is famous for its historic brownstones and iconic 'white-glove' apartment buildings along Central Park West and Riverside Drive.
